But these things counterbalance the distance.

By the way, do you know that Mrs.Morres is in town ?" "I had not heard." "She has come up for a week's shopping." "Ah! I must call on her.

I like her douches of cold water on all our schemes." "So do I." He looked at her with a dawning intention in his eyes.

Before he could speak the words that were on his lips the opposite door opened, and a young woman, wearing an artist's blouse, with close-cropped dark hair and a frank boyish face, came out.
"I beg your pardon, Miss Gray, do you happen to have any methylated spirit ?" "Good-night, Miss Gray." He lifted his hat and went down the stairs.

On the next landing he paused and listened with a smile to the conversation overhead.
